We have hull #3 and it is called a 2007. Not sure about the original heads, but I suspect the Jabsco in the forward head was a replacement. It suffered from hose kink that ultimately leaked and created an ugly few hours. The full porcelain design means you can't access the mechanisms without removing the head from the base. It looks nice, but is completely unserviceable. Form follows function for me. The Raritan design leaves everything out there to be serviced and works perfectly. Of course, it's brand new now...

I don't know that our Y valve is stuck, but it wouldn't surprise me. It is physically locked as that is the requirement here in on the US side of the Great Lakes. It is locked so that the pump out branch of the valve is open, and that all works fine. The macerator motor turned when we surveyed it, but it has not been tested under fire, so to speak.
